Top Loading Arms: Enhancing Safety and Efficiency in Bulk Liquid Transfer

In the realm of bulk liquid transfer operations, safety is paramount. Top loading arms stand as a beacon of efficiency and reliability, optimizing the process while mitigating potential hazards. These robust systems effortlessly connect to storage tanks, facilitating the reliable transfer of liquids such as fuel, chemicals, and water. The innovative design of top loading arms incorporates capabilities that decrease the risk of spills, leaks, and interaction with harmful substances.

  • Employing a overhead design, top loading arms efficiently connect to storage tanks, avoiding any ground-level contact with the transferred liquids.
  • Furnished with reliable valves and connections, these arms provide a secure seal, minimizing the risk of accidental spills.
  • Moreover, top loading arms often feature controlled systems that track flow rates and pressure levels, improving operational exactness.

By adopting top loading arms, industries can attain significant gains in both safety and efficiency, making them an essential component of modern bulk liquid transfer operations.

Advanced Marine Loading Arm Design Features

Modern marine loading arms utilize cutting-edge design elements to ensure safe and efficient fluid transfer onspot loading arm operations. These advanced features encompass enhanced mechanical integrity, streamlined hydraulic systems for smooth articulation, and integrated protection mechanisms. Furthermore, many loading arms are equipped with intelligent sensors and control platforms to monitor performance, detect anomalies, and minimize the risk of spills or leaks.

  • Corrosion-resistant materials like stainless steel and high-performance alloys are frequently used in construction to withstand harsh marine environments.
  • Articulation points feature sealed bearings and lubrication systems to maximize lifespan and reduce maintenance requirements.
  • Automatic pressure relief valves guarantee safe operation by reducing excessive pressure buildup.
